Honest review, no techie stuff
First off - if you want a full system then this isn’t for you. What you get is a box and a couple of leads. Exactly what it says on the tin. Well packaged, everything already installed, just plug in and switch on. Now book a two week holiday to any destination and when you return the windows update may be 80% if you’re lucky. Same with every computer tho. Comes with Norton pre loaded which I personally hate and will be removed (personal taste) Anyway back to the box - very quiet considering there are 5 fans going, feels icy cold in there so no need to update when upgrade time comes. Speed - no complaints there, runs WoT on high specs no lag. All my other games are old so no issues there. Quite a large system so plenty of space for adding upgrades etc. the LED’s on the fans are controlled by a button on top. Yes you will pressing this alot till you get one scheme you like (think there is over 100 settings) hold the button to switch the lights off if you are going to have this in a bedroom and leave the pc on or you will have sleepless nights. Been running this for a couple of days and no issues. Hooked it up to a 4k TV and its a glorious experience. Well worth the time invested in research. Highly recommeded ⭐️⭐️⭐️⭐️⭐️

Good value, no issues with PC, Would recommend this seller/product.
Bought as my old laptop had become really slow, very happy with the PC. Setting it up was pretty easy and you receive an itinerary of all the parts (graphics card etc) including the boxes the parts came in too. I was able to install a WIFI adapter card (which I purchased separately) to the motherboard easily too. (The USB wi-fi dongle it comes with WILL disconnect all the time) but that is not really the fault of the seller, those USB things just have a terrible range. I haven't used the PC that much tbh as been busy but I haven't had any issues, I tend to only play OSRS so its a bit overkill for that but I wanted something that would last and be capable of a high level of processing for gaming / video editing etc, this company made it super easy and the PC was well priced. Would recommend!
